Access, Rectification, or Erasure of Data
In accordance with Belgian privacy legislation and the provisions of the GDPR, you have the following rights:
- Right of access: you have the right to obtain free access to your data and to know how it is being used.
- Right to rectification: you have the right to request correction of inaccurate personal data, as well as to complete incomplete personal data.
- Right to erasure or restriction: you may request deletion or restriction of your personal data under certain conditions as defined by the GDPR. We may refuse deletion or restriction of data that is necessary to comply with a legal obligation, to perform the agreement, or for our legitimate interest.
- Right to data portability: you have the right to obtain the personal data you provided to us in a structured, commonly used, and machine-readable format, and you may transfer this data to another controller.
- Right to object: you have the right to object to the processing of your personal data on serious and legitimate grounds. Please note, however, that you cannot object to the processing of data necessary for compliance with legal obligations, contract performance, or our legitimate interest.
- Right to withdraw consent: if processing is based on prior consent, you have the right to withdraw your consent at any time. Such data will then only be processed if another legal basis exists.
- Automated decision-making and profiling: we confirm that the processing of personal data does not include profiling and that you are not subject to fully automated decisions.
